Betty Salley Obituary

Salley – Mrs. Betty Faye Leach Salley, 92, went home to be with Jesus on Thursday, May 6, 2021.

Mrs. Betty is the loving wife of the late Nathan “Bob” Robert Salley, Sr. for 67 years prior to his passing this past January. She is the mother of Nathan Robert Salley, Jr. and his wife Sharon, Henry “Hank” McLeod Salley and his wife Leslie, Rhett Cullum Salley and his wife Gwen, and Paul DeWitt Salley and his wife Tina. Mrs. Betty is the Grandma of Ryan Lamar Salley and his wife Samantha, Valerie Sappenfield and her husband Scott, Lloyd Turner and his wife Stacey, Brent Turner and his fiancé Allison, Audrey Salley McKay and her husband Ian, Mindy Dawn Salley, Maegwen Betty Massie and her husband Kyle, Joshua DeWitt Salley, and Christopher Nathan Salley. She is the great grandma of Emma Shephard, Morgan Alexis Salley, Charlotte Rose Salley, Kate Sappenfield, Sam Sappenfield, Logan Turner, Autumn Shelor, Ivy Shelor, Abigail Grace McKay, Melanie McKay, Nathan “Nate” DeWitt Salley, and Della DeShannon Salley.  Mrs. Betty is the daughter of the late Cain McLeod Leach and the late Henrietta Holt Leach. She is the sister of Janet McLeod Knopf and her late husband Dr. Reuben DeLoach Knopf, and the late Donna Rose Reeves and her husband the late Marion Sims Reeves. She has numerous nieces and nephews.

Mrs. Betty was a faithful member of Salley Baptist Church where she led the WMU and sang in the choir. She was a Cub Scout Den Mother, a member of the Salley Rescue Squad, a member of the Hen House Ministries, a member of the Palmetto Painters Artist Guild, a member of the Society of Decorative Painters, and a member of the Edisto Singers. She was a devoted and supportive wife to Mr. Bob in all his countless endeavors while raising four boys. Mrs. Betty enjoyed spending many happy hours with her grandchildren and great grandchildren.
